The Netherlands is divided into provinces, each with its own government led by the Governor (Commissaris van de Koning - The King's Commissioner) and its provincial assemblies elected in a direct vote every four years. The largest urban network is known as Randstad, including the largest four cities in the Netherlands ( Amsterdam, Rotterdam, The Hague and Utrecht ). Provinces of the Netherlands The Netherlands has twelve provinces: Noord-Holland, Zuid-Holland, Zeeland, Noord-Brabant, Utrecht, Flevoland, Friesland, Groningen, Drenthe, Overijssel, Gelderland and Limburg.
